Sarah Goble was born in 1638 in Malden, Middlesex County, Massachusetts, United States of America, the child of Thomas Goble And Alice Mousall. Sarah Goble married John Shepard, and had children including Daniel Shepard, Dorothy Shepard, Isaac Shepard, John Shepard, Martha Shepard, Mary Shephard, Rachel Shepard, Sarah Shepard, Sarah Shepherd. Sarah Goble passed away in 1717 in Littleton, Middlesex County, Massachusetts, United States of America.
